Rational Rose and UML 2.0






The version of Rational Rose that is available through an academic licence, supports only UML 1.4 and not 2.0. Some features that we learned in the lectures belong to UML 2.0 (e.g. conditional and iterative messages and blocks of code represented with a frame). There is no direct way to express these in RR. The specification menu of a message in an interaction diagram shows all the possible types of messages that are supported:



You may use an indirect way to record the features that are not supported. For example, you may associate a note with a message in order to show that it is conditional.
